The Athletics are on a 2-8 slide and play their sixth consecutive road game. The offense is 17th in on-base percentage and 28th in steals. They're being outscored by 60 runs, the third-worst in the AL. Jeffrey Springs (4.27 ERA) walks a lot of batters (21 in 46+ innings), while the bullpen is 28th in ERA (5.76). The San Francisco offense is eighth in runs scored and has taken the first two of this series by a 10-1 count. Justin Verlander is rounding into form, allowing 3 runs or less in five straight starts. The Giants have the No. 1 relief pitching in the majors (2.59 ERA) and are 15-7 at home. Play San Francisco.

The Athletics' offense is 15th in on-base percentage and last in steals. Luis Severino comes off a bad outing against the best offense in the AL, the Yankees. But he's been very good overall, especially on the road, where he has a 0.95 ERA holding the home teams to a .206 average. However, the team is outscored by 59 runs, the third-worst in the AL. The Athletics are on a 2-7 slide and play their fifth straight on the road. The San Francisco offense is 16th in on-base percentage and 23rd in steals. Starter Landen Roupp throws well at home (3.72 ERA), and the Giants have the No. 1 relief pitching in the majors (2.66 ERA). The Giants are 14-7 at home, so back home field in a defensive duel. Play the Giants and UNDER the total.
